Focus on Quality Over Quantity

You just want to post and you hope that the more you post the more you will attract interaction. However, in the small accounts, quality, and considered posts tend to work better than low-effort and frequent posts. You can write inviting captions, use images and other visuals that are memorable and post what is really personal or related to the niche. Authenticity is also a response that audiences react to and authentic posts tend to invite interactions.

Encourage Conversations

The number of likes is not the only thing in interaction but rather provoking the discussion. It is desirable to post open-ended questions and reply to the comments as promptly as possible, and it is desirable to ask the followers to give their ideas or experiences. Small accounts are advantageous in that it is more friendly and this is why you should take the best out of it by ensuring that you make it comfortable place where the followers can be heard and appreciated.

Use Stories and Interactive Features

A wide range of platforms provides such features as polls, quizzes, or stickers to ask me anything. Small accounts can use these tools as they are ideal due to their ability to generate low-pressure interactions with followers instantly. Short and informal content such as stories or status updates will ensure that your audience stays interested every day and that you are active and interested in communicating with them.

Collaborate with Others

Small accounts can also benefit in the collaborations. Cooperation with other creators within your own industry helps to cross-sell content, share audiences, and interact more. A collaboration does not necessarily have to be large or excessive, the most basic form of collaboration is a mere shout-out, livestream, or even a challenge to collaborate, and this will make your profile visible to new interested followers.

Consistency and Timing

It is better to keep a regular schedule that would remind your audience when they get new content and that would be more appealing. On the same note, it may be important to reflect on the time when your followers are at their best. The slight modifications like posting in the evenings or during weekends when they are the ones that your audience are in their active mode may lead to higher comments, shares, and overall interaction.
